A fleet enema is a disposable laxative enema (or clyster). It is intended for treating constipation or cleansing the bowel, often before medical procedures. It may also be used for other conditions.

Yes, you can administer a fleet enema to yourself, as it is designed for home use. However, it's important to follow the instructions on the packaging carefully to ensure safety and effectiveness. If you have any underlying health conditions or concerns, consulting a healthcare professional before using an enema is advisable.
